Abstract

一种超声图像处理系统,包括:数据接收模块(110),用于获取同一目标组织对应的多组三维图像数据;图像分析模块(130),用于基于多组三维图像数据中的任意一组三维图像数据,分割目标区域,获得目标区域的三维体结构边界、及沿该三维体结构边界外扩或内缩生成的安全边界;图像映射模块(120),用于建立多组三维图像数据之间的空间映射关系,并根据空间映射关系,将目标区域的三维体结构边界和安全边界映射到其他组三维图像数据中;以及图像标记模块(150),用于在显示图像中标记目标区域分别在多组三维图像数据中相对应的三维体结构边界和安全边界、或位于三维体结构边界和安全边界内的区域。该系统能够解决现有技术中无法对治疗过程中的超声图像进行汇总分析及定量显示的问题。
